8 Admiral Walk is a two-bedroom semi-detached house in Lincoln (LN2 4RZ). It has a recorded floor area of 57 m² (around 614 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1991-1995 and council tax band B. The latest certificate (February 2020) shows a C (score 69), just inside the C band. The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 87).
Held since July 2006 — that's 20 years off the open market, well above the local norm. Across the public record there are 4 sales, relatively high churn for a single property. Sale prices here have outpaced Lincoln HPI: 11.8% per year against 0% for the wider region. Today's modelled estimate of £165,000 sits 50% above the 2006 sale of £110,000.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£179/sq ft) was about 59% above the typical sold price in the postcode.
